About the NEOMI SEEP project

The New Earth Observation Mission Idea (NEOMI) / Study of Energetic Particle Precipitation (SEEP) is a project supported by ESA (Contract No. 4000150446/26/NL/FFi).

The mission idea aims to improve our understanding of how energetic particle precipitation (EPP) influences atmospheric and near-Earth space processes by using low or very low (below 400 km altitude) Earth orbit satellite(s).

The project brings together an interdisciplinary community spanning magnetospheric physics, atmospheric science, and space weather to ensure the mission addresses key scientific and societal needs.
